Sour and tart apples give a nice tang that offsets the cake’s sweet side. Choose apples like Granny Smith, Honey Crisp, or Pink Lady. They mix well with the cake’s sweetness.

Planning to eat the cake later? Here’s how to store it right:
Keep it in an airtight container. Then, put it in the fridge.
It will still taste great and stay fluffy for 3 days.
Make sure it’s fully cooled before storing. This stops it from getting too damp.
